While kayaking through Robinson Preserve in Bradenton, Fl I came to appreciate the challenge of bird photography, of which, I have no experience. Especially after viewing magnificent images here on UHH. Floating around in a kayak trying to capture a sharp image of a bird who apparently did not understand "sit-stay.." will take more learning and practice on my part. With that said, here are a few images I came up with. I was on shore when I snapped the Blue Heron photo. Comments, suggestions and critiques welcomed.
